9 Ways to Fix Twitch Not Working on iPhone and Android

Twitch is one of the best platforms for interacting and connecting with the gaming community. While the app is optimized for iPhone and Android devices for the most part, we still encounter issues. If you Facing any problem Twitch not working on iPhone and Android, here's a guide to help fix it.

Issues can range from streaming that buffers all the time, not being able to send a message in live chat, to frequent app crashes, and beyond. With some tried-and-tested methods, we'll help you restore Twitch app functionality. But first, let's understand why these issues arise.

Why is the TWITCH app not working on my phone?

Here are some reasons why we can determine if the Twitch app is refusing to work on your device.

  • No good internet connection.
  • Server issues on Twitch.
  • Bugs on iPhone or Android app.
  • Twitch app is outdated.

The list can go on and on, and it can be difficult to pinpoint the exact cause of the problem. However, what's not difficult is how to fix it. Let's get started.

1. Check if Twitch is down now

If Twitch is experiencing a downtime due to issues with their servers, it will affect their streaming services. Therefore, all you have to do is wait for Twitch to restart their servers. You can check the server status for your switch at third-party website , or also keep up with updates via Twitch's official social media handles.

However, if everything is fine on Twitch, you may need to check your device's internet connection.

2. Check your internet connection

Make sure you have an adequate internet connection speed to get the most out of the Twitch mobile app. You'll need a Wi-Fi connection with adequate signal strength or a good mobile internet connection. Additionally, make sure you have an active internet plan by contacting your service provider.

3. Enable cellular data for Twitch

Your iPhone or Android device has the option to turn off mobile data for specific apps. Once you do this, the apps will not connect to mobile networks and will function normally. Therefore, make sure you haven't disabled mobile data access for Twitch.

Enable Cellular Data for Twitch on iPhone

Step 1: Open an app Settings.

Step 2: Open Cellular/Telephone Data Scroll down to find Twitch. Make sure the toggle switch for Twitch is turned on, if it isn't already.

5. Clear cache and data for the Twitch app (Android only)

A nice feature on Android is the ability to clear the app cache and data. This deletes all the data that Twitch has accumulated over time. Apps store some temporary local data called cache to load items quickly when you open the app, rather than downloading them again.

Once you clear the cache data, you may be able to fix a buggy Twitch app. However, keep in mind that clearing the app data will log you out of the app.

Step 1: Long press on the icon Twitch app Click on the icon the information.

Step 2: Click on Storage usage.

Step 3: Click on Wipe data And clear the cache.

6. Reboot the device

Restarting your phone refreshes all services running on your operating system and allows you to start a new session. Doing so also shuts down Twitch completely.

This is known to solve many software related issues and definitely has a good chance of fixing a buggy Twitch app.

Restart iPhone

Step 1: First , Turn off your device.

  • On iPhone X and later Press and hold the volume down and side buttons.
  • On iPhone SE 2nd or 3rd gen, 7 and 8 series: Press and hold the side button.
  • On iPhone SE 1st gen, 5s, 5c, or 5: Press and hold the power button on top.

8. Update the Twitch app

If a large group of users are experiencing an issue with the Twitch app, it's likely caused by a bug in that specific version. Twitch will likely notice this and release a fix via an update. Therefore, make sure you're running the latest Twitch update. Here's how to update the app.
